The Pros and Cons of Condo Living in Downtown Austin

Austin, Texas, is a vibrant and rapidly growing city known for its live music, food scene, and a thriving tech industry. With the city's increasing popularity, downtown Austin has become a hotspot for residents looking for a blend of urban living and a taste of the unique Austin culture. Condo living in downtown Austin has become a popular choice for many, but like any housing option, it comes with its own set of advantages and disadvantages. In this blog, we'll explore the pros and cons of condo living in downtown Austin to help you make an informed decision if you're considering this lifestyle.

Pros of Condo Living in Downtown Austin:

  1. Location, Location, Location: Downtown Austin offers a unique experience with easy access to the city's best restaurants, bars, theaters, and cultural events. Living in a condo here means you're at the heart of it all, with the convenience of walking to many attractions.
  2. Amenities Galore: Condo complexes in downtown Austin often come with a wide range of amenities, including fitness centers, pools, rooftop terraces, and concierge services. These perks can enhance your quality of life and create a sense of luxury.
  3. Low Maintenance: Condos typically require less maintenance than single-family homes. Many condo associations take care of common areas and exterior maintenance, allowing you to focus on your work or leisure activities.
  4. Community Feel: Condo living can offer a strong sense of community. You'll be living in close proximity to your neighbors, making it easier to forge connections with like-minded individuals who share your interests.
  5. Safety and Security: Most condo buildings have security measures in place, such as controlled access, surveillance cameras, and on-site staff. This can provide peace of mind, especially if you travel frequently or live alone.
  6. Investment Potential: Downtown Austin real estate has been appreciating steadily in recent years. Owning a condo in a prime location can be a wise long-term investment, potentially increasing in value over time.

Cons of Condo Living in Downtown Austin:

  1. Limited Space: Condos typically offer less space than single-family homes. If you have a growing family or require ample room for hobbies or storage, you might find condo living restrictive.
  2. Monthly HOA Fees: Condo living comes with monthly homeowners association (HOA) fees to cover shared amenities, maintenance, and other communal costs. These fees can add up, impacting your overall budget.
  3. Noise and Crowds: Downtown living means you're close to the action, but it also means exposure to noise and crowds, especially during events and festivals. If you value peace and quiet, condo living may not be the best fit.
  4. Limited Outdoor Space: While many condos offer shared outdoor spaces or balconies, they typically lack the sprawling yards and gardens that single-family homes can provide. This can be a drawback if you love gardening or outdoor activities.
  5. Lack of Privacy: Living in close quarters with neighbors can mean limited privacy. Thin walls and shared common areas can make it difficult to escape the prying eyes and ears of those around you.
  6. Resale Restrictions: Some condo associations may impose restrictions on renting or selling your unit. This can limit your flexibility if you need to move or want to rent out your condo.
